Known limitations include:
- The synchronized data should be in accordance to Planner Premium plans limits and boundaries: Project for the web limits and boundaries
- Task custom fields are not synchronized yet (implementation is on the roadmap)
- Project custom fields are not synchronized yet (need feedback if it is needed)
- Resource custom fields are not synchronized
- The Agile view is not synchronized yet
- Bookable resources are not created automatically in the Dataverse / CRM. The sync process tries to match the resources by their names / emails / logins.
- The tool currently takes date matches as a priority over duration matches. In other words, in case of scheduling differences caused by different calendars, the tool will try to enforce the Start and Finish dates to match, even if it will sacrifice the Duration matching.
- Task fields currently being synchronized: "Task Name", "Outline Level", "Start Date", "Finish Date", "Duration", "Notes", “% Complete”, “Work”, “Actual Work”, “Task Type”
- As Task Type is set only at the Plan level in Planner Premium / Project Operations and can’t be changed after creation, Task Type synchronization can’t be done 2-way, and only synchronized from Planner / Project Operations to MPP
- Variations in Task types in the MPP file can't be synchronized to Planner Premium / Project Operations plan due to the limitation mentioned above, and can result in deviations in synchronized data.
- Duration units unsupported by Planner Premium / Project Operations, such as elapsed days/weeks are not guaranteed to be processed correctly.
- Manually scheduled leaf tasks are synchronized but not fully supported by Planner / Project Operations and may not be scheduled/synchronized properly.
- Manually scheduled Summary Tasks are not supported and will be synchronized as automatically scheduled, with start & end dates calculated based on child tasks.
- External tasks are excluded from the synchronization by default. If included and synchronized to Planner / Project Operations, they may affect the parent Summary task(a) and can cause inaccuracies in the synchronized schedule.
- Individual task calendars are not supported, and the schedule that is heavily reliant on task calendars may be synchronized incorrectly.
- Master Projects support is not complete
- Sub-projects are not automatically synchronized from the Master Plan with individual Planner Plans / Project Operations Projects, even when connected to Planner plans with Project Sync
- Sub-projects can be opened individually and synchronized to connected Planner Plans / Project Operations Projects, not affecting the Master Plan connected to their Master Project
- Inactive tasks are not synchronized to Planner Premium / Project Operations Projects to avoid scheduling inaccuracies
- Manual tasks or tasks scheduled with elapsed duration units that start and finish over the non-working days require setting the project calendar in Planner / Project Operations to include these days as working (e.g. 24/7 or 8/7 calendar). Using 24/7 calendar can be helpful to have the Work values calculated the same way as in Project Desktop in case of elapsed days duration units.
- Using 24/7 calendar (e.g. as suggested above) can lead to limitations in task duration that are shorter then the limitation officially suggested by the official service limitation documentation. The documented limitation is 1250 days for leaf tasks; however, with 24/7 calendar the maximum leaf task duration is ~416 days. Both values are 10,000 hours, which seems to be the true limitation.
- Baselines are not yet fully supported by the Planner / Project Operations and not synchronized
- The following task constraints are not supported by Planner / Project Operations and tasks that utilize these are synchronized using supported types of constraints
- As late as possible
- Start no later than
- Finish no later than
- Must finish on
- Must start on
- "Schedule from setting" at the project level is not supported by the Planner / Project Operations and not synchronized
- Recurring tasks are not supported by the Planner / Project Operations and are synchronized as individual, unrelated tasks
- Task Deadlines are not supported
- Resource Assignment units are not supported by Planner / Project Operations and are "emulated" during the synchronization using the timephased assignment data entry
- Resource assignments made to the Summary Tasks are not supported by Planner / Project Operations and can't be synchronized.
